Product description
Neproplast HDPE pipes are engineered for demanding gas applications, delivering reliable performance in Bahrain's challenging environment. Manufactured from high-density polyethylene (PE80), these pipes combine exceptional strength with lightweight construction, making them easy to handle and install across projects in Manama, Muharraq, and Riffa.
These pipes are built to withstand high operating pressures up to 12.5 bar, ensuring safe and efficient gas conveyance. Their inherent resistance to bacteria, insects, heat, and ultraviolet radiation makes them a durable choice for both above-ground and buried installations. The smooth surface eliminates the need for painting, reducing maintenance costs over the long term.
With an outside diameter of 250 mm and a wall thickness of 22.7 mm, these pipes offer robust structural integrity. They are supplied in standard 12-meter lengths, with custom lengths available upon request. The pipes can be joined securely using electric welding (electrofusion), creating leak-proof connections that meet the highest safety standards.
Key Features
- PE80 high-density polyethylene material
- Nominal pressure: 12.5 bar
- Outside diameter: 250 mm
- Wall thickness: 22.7 mm
- Standard dimension ratio (SDR): 11
- Sigma (design stress): 6.3 MPa
- Minimum required strength (MRS): 8 MPa
- Series (S): 5
- Weight: 16.184 kg per meter
- Yellow color (other colors available on request)
- Length: 12 meters standard (custom lengths on request)
